Output 4ccd1926bf83698581f3246add263dce29b81c19b2e49a75ce3cca541fb80f16:179

value
46679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b73afbf8c2b085695f604d30078c300b437b334 OP_EQUAL
address
3LEmgXRkF1imzfr3uA6G9JaoTGBXYR5bZm
transaction
4ccd1926bf83698581f3246add263dce29b81c19b2e49a75ce3cca541fb80f16
confirmations
176644
spent
true